Output 27c379e96b43bb0f27bd52ced0cf88404dcbb858eb980fa97409a8c42fd19f19:0

value
346956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81438d1f49ccc57bc82c8d7c4d93c45595e9b6c2 OP_EQUAL
address
3DUW1qJXi1MdT6rVa8BXSRFj69kGGRvZ1W
transaction
27c379e96b43bb0f27bd52ced0cf88404dcbb858eb980fa97409a8c42fd19f19